‘The work adopts the form of a concerto for large orchestra. Each instrumental
group is induced to display its specific powers or virtues in dialogue sequences in
the form of antiphonals, before blending into the clamour of the tutti. The work’s
two parts are separated by a barred rest, which, without interrupting the advance,
announces the Conjuration des sorts (‘casting of fates’). Between the various
episodes, a sort of refrain recalls the landscape serving as a backdrop for the
whole work: a clair de terre (‘earthlight’) with veiled, changing colours as if
everything were unfolding under the silent gaze of a distant star split in two,
which would be our earth.’
‘In the history of this century, there are many hydras, which we have not been
able to control and which have caused enormous ravages without our knowing
exactly why or from whence they came. The whole nomenclature of Le Livre des
Prodiges is made up of allusions to this kind of event, ancient or contemporary.
And when they are contemporary, they seem in fact a reincarnation of myths that
have already terrorised or favoured Man. I lay particular stress on this point.
There is always an immemorial memory that is ever present.’

TOMBEAU DE CLAUDE DEBUSSY (no. 52) Playing time: approx. 31’


for voice and orchestra
7 parts: I-Hommage; II-Soleils; III-Ballade de la Grande Guerre; IV-Autres
soleils; V-Miroir endormi; VI-Rose des vents et de la pluie; VII-Envoi
" Forces: solo soprano (vocalise) and orchestra 1.1.1.1, 1.1.0.0, percussion (6
performers), cithara in thirds of tones, celesta, piano (with 3rd pedal), strings
4.4.3.2.1 (can be increased to 6.6.4.4.2 maximum)
Percussion instruments: xylophone, marimba, glockenspiel, vibraphone, celesta, 8
tom-toms (tuned A, B, C, D, E, F, A flat, B flat), 2 side drums (with snare and
snareless), small drum, tambourine, 1 mambo, bass drum, guiro, tam-tam, large
cymbal and small suspended cymbal, maracas, triangle, crotale, 2 temple blocks
